Pros

good location and free coffee

Cons

they just dont care about the health or wellbeing of analytics reps. we had an earthquake evacuation drill, they made me us stay at our desks while the alarm screamed and the lights flashed, while the rest of the building evacuated. they dehumanize the reps, the SF analytics department head carries a sweatshop mentality and everybody hates her for it
